Echelon Stride Treadmill This sleek treadmill folds flat and then rolls away which makes it a great option for those who live in apartments. The built-in tablet holder connects to Echelon United, a subscription platform for fitness that lets you stream live and on-demand running classes taught by top instructors. The treadmill comes with a touchscreen console that displays standard metrics such as speed, distance and pace. The treadmill also has incline and pace buttons, as well as eight pre-set exercises. The console has an USB port on the back. I used the console to charge my iPad running Echelon Fit (more about that below). The Stride is a great choice however it is devoid of an HD touchscreen. Its belt measures 55 inches in length which is ample for jogging and walking, but may not be long enough for taller runners or those who plan to run at high speeds. The motor is rated at 1.75 CHP, which is less powerful than other treadmills I've tested, but still manages to do the job. The Stride is easy to fold and roll once it's time to get rid of your treadmill. The treadmill folded down is 10 inches wide and can be folded up against a wall or under furniture. The console portion and handlebars can be folded down with the lever. The machine will fold automatically when you press the pedal. You just need to lift the handlebars at the end of the machine to move it. Its small footprint and low price make it a good choice for those who live in apartments, but anyone seeking more advanced features should consider other treadmills on this list. Echelon Treadmill The treadmill can be folded flat and rolled under the couch or under the bed when not in use. Its compact design makes it a great choice for apartment dwellers who don't have a lot of extra space. It's easy to assemble and lightweight enough to be able to get away after your exercise. This model is among the cheapest on our list. It's loaded with features. It has a maximum speed of 12mph and an incline of up to 10 percent. The package includes a free 30-day Echelon Premier membership that gives you access to on-demand and live fitness classes. The Echelon App connects to the treadmill quickly and reliably. It also responds quickly when you make changes to your on-screen statistics. The app provides a variety of guided workouts including scenic runs that show videos of beautiful landscapes while you train. The treadmill does not come with a touchscreen and if you wish to stream fitness classes via other platforms, you'll need bring your smartphone or tablet. This treadmill does not have a USB charging port, which can be an issue for those who want to charge their devices while exercising. The treadmill also has a narrow belt than some of our other options, which could be an issue for taller runners. It can be used on carpet but you'll need a mat on top of it or heavy-duty interlocking floor tiles to keep the tread from breaking up the carpet.
